SBEM (Simplified Building Energy Model) provides an analysis of a buildings energy consumption, as required by the European Energy Performance Directive (EPBD). The calculation method is also used in determining CO2 emission rates for new buildings in compliance with Part L of the Building Regulations (England & Wales) and Part F (Northern Ireland). SBEM is used in relation with commercial/industrial/retail buildings.
There are 2 stages
The first stage (Design stage) needs to be completed and submitted to your Building Control Body or Approved Inspector at the same time as your Building Control Application.
The second stage (As-built stage) comes into force when the build is completed and a 'pass' Certificate will need to be produced for presentation to your Inspector. The final certificate includes all changes to the building design and your certified air test results. (See Industrial/Commercial Air Testing with Air Assure)
